Gabby Barrett and her husband Cade Foehner are throwing it back to 2007 with a cover of Faith Hill and Tim McGraw’s 2007 hit, “I Need You.”
Barrett shared the clip on her Instagram this week, writing, “Love him. And this song.”
The video, which was originally filmed in late 2019, features the pair singing the heartfelt ballad in a bathroom. Barrett joked that they chose to sing the song in the bathroom because it has the “best acoustics.”
“I Need You” was written by David Lee and Tony Lane and released in 2007 as the second single from McGraw‘s Let It Go album. The track went on to become one of the couple’s most beloved duets.
This isn’t the newlyweds’ first time covering an iconic duet. Earlier this year, they joined forces for a cover of Blake Shelton and Gwen Stefani’s “Nobody But You.”
